• Sturridge and Christian Benteke find rapport in trainingBrendan Rodgers believes Daniel Sturridge will elevate Liverpool’s game to a new dimension” having seen evidence of an instant rapport in training between the England striker and the £32.5m summer signing, Christian Benteke.
Sturridge could feature for Liverpool for the first time since 8 April when Norwich City play at Anfield on Sunday. The 26-year-old was restricted to 18 club appearances last season due to thigh, or calf and hip injuries and underwent surgery in the United States in May to resolve long-standing fitness problems. An intensive rehabilitation programme has enabled Sturridge to resume full training a month ahead of schedule and,though he may maintain to settle for a substitute’s introduction against Norwich, Rodgers expects the striker to maintain a major impact on Liverpool’s performance level.
